In our previous KETIV Virtual Academy Session, Autodesk Account Portal 101, we covered the ins and outs of the Autodesk Account Portal at manage.autodesk.com.

In this session, Customer Success Manager Brian Mongkolpoonsuk will dive a bit deeper into the Autodesk Account Portal. He will cover the latest updates and features such as:

-New Usage Report Tab added to the Autodesk Portal (manage.autodesk.com)

-KETIV Reporting to clean-up your data

-FLEX Token usage visibility (and what FLEX Token licensing is)

-BONUS: New “In-Product” message that warns about Subscription overuse
